This is a historic Christian house of worship was at one time affiliated with the Presbyterian Church and located at the intersection of Sussex Turnpike and Church Road in the Mount Freedom section of Randolph Township. Today it serves ad a house of worship for members on the Korean community. The church building was built in 1868 and added to the National Register of Historic Places in 1991. The Church is no longer used as a church.
